Internships Opportunities
There were lot of studios and design firms recommended by our faculty to check in and apply for. I did get a internship opportunity from a startup firm which helped me in hands-on work and learnt about the market, helping me in my personal and professional growth. The firm also provided me with a decent amount of stipend of 7k a month. Handled projects which were taught in class at some point and the challenges and questioned were resolved while we were directly working in that situation.
Fees and Financial Aid
Fees had been hiked right when I joined the college, it was 30k earlier but now it's 65k. Reason god knows The scholarship eligible students are still paying the full fees even when they are not required to pay, where the state government had promised to pay. The university management asks the students instead to pay the full fees until the government sanctions the amount.

Admission
I took the exam of NATA, JEE MAINS P2, Both the results were taken into consideration by the State Architecture Rank . The cut off depends on the category you belong to. The final admission is done on the basis of your SAR(State Architecture Rank) Course eligibility is to pass matriculation, 12th with 60 percentage of results in the subject Maths and Science background. Reservation benifits are the University holds reserved 60percenr seats for the Andhra University affiliated students (From Andhra Region) in the , 40 percent seats for the Osmania University affiliation students (From Telangana Region)and remaining for other. The exam and difficulty are balance enough to test the student and grant admission, the exam does has aptitude and physics and drawing challenges. Admission process need no improvement.
